Login
Start Free Trial Are you a business?? Click Here

EmpowerWays Reviews

1.7 Rating 39 Reviews
15 %
of reviewers recommend EmpowerWays
Visit Website

Phone:

+41275087719

Email:

support@empowerways.com

Write Your review

olivetraderecover55 AT g mail com got my lost investment
EmpowerWays 3 star review on 8th May 2025
Helpful Report
Posted 3 weeks ago
EmpowerWays is rated 1.7 based on 39 reviews